The Montessori Event 2026
Washington, D.C. | March 19–22, 2026
The American Montessori Society invites proposals for research presentations at The Montessori Event 2026. Share your scholarship and classroom-based research inquiry with the world’s largest gathering of Montessori educators and contribute to a global culture of research, equity, and innovation.
Focus Areas
We welcome studies and action research related to Montessori education, especially in:
- Teaching & Learning – literacy, numeracy, STEM, neurodiversity, assessment
- Whole-Child & Belonging – SEL, identity, restorative practices, equity
- Leadership & Systems – teacher retention, coaching, governance, enrollment
- Innovation & Global Lens – technology, AI, outdoor learning, sustainability, global competence
- Teacher Education & Policy – mentorship, pathways, accreditation
Formats
- Paper (20 min + Q&A)
- Action Research Brief (10 min)
- Symposium (60 min, 3–4 papers)
- Workshop (60 min, interactive)
- Lightning Talk (7 min)
Submission Requirements
- Abstract (≤ 500 words): purpose, methods, findings/expected findings, implications
- 3–5 keywords, presenter bios (75–100 words each)
- IRB/ethics status
